Antico Forno Roscioli ★ 4.5

Bakery, pizza al tagliocentro-storico

The Roscioli family's Antico Forno in Rome's Centro Storico is the 200-year-old neighbourhood bakery counter, with pizza bianca, pizza rossa, and the city's best maritozzo to order.

Signature: Pizza bianca, Pizza rossa, Maritozzo

Order: Pizza bianca (the classic), pizza rossa with anchovies, and a maritozzo con la panna.

Tip: Open Mon to Sat 07:00 to 19:30; closed Sunday. The maritozzo sells out by 11:00.

Osteria Da Fortunata ★ 4.0

Roman trattoria€€centro-storico

Osteria Da Fortunata in Rome's Centro Storico is the pasta-by-hand trattoria where you watch the pasta makers roll fettuccine in the window from a long marble counter.

Signature: Fettuccine, Cacio e pepe, Tagliatelle al ragu

Order: Fettuccine al ragu, cacio e pepe rolled fresh in the window, and a quartino of house white.

Tip: No bookings; queue from 19:00. Three locations across the centre; the Via del Pellegrino is the original.

Pizzeria Ai Marmi ★ 4.1

Roman pizzatrastevere

Pizzeria Ai Marmi in Rome's Trastevere is the Sunday-evening institution with marble-table tops, paper-thin Roman pizzas and queues that wrap onto Viale Trastevere by 20:00.

Signature: Roman pizza, Suppli, Fritti

Order: Pizza margherita, suppli al telefono, fritti misti including baccala.

Tip: Closed Wednesday. No bookings; queue starts 19:30. Cash and card; the room turns fast.

I Suppli ★ 4.0

Street food, friggitoriatrastevere

I Suppli in Rome's Trastevere is the no-frills friggitoria counter selling suppli, fiori di zucca and potato croquettes by weight, the standing-up cousin to Supplizio.

Signature: Suppli, Fiori di zucca, Crocchette di patate

Order: Suppli al telefono and fiori di zucca fritti, plus crocchette di patate on the side.

Tip: Cash only. Open 11:00 to 22:00; standing only. The 19:00 fryer batch is the freshest.

Ai Tre Scalini ★ 4.2

Roman wine bar€€monti

Ai Tre Scalini in Rome's Monti district is the wine-bar trattoria with a 200-bottle list, the polpette al sugo lunch carte and the small front pavement seats for aperitivo.

Signature: Tonnarelli cacio e pepe, Polpette al sugo, Caprese

Order: Polpette al sugo, tonnarelli cacio e pepe and a glass of Lazio Cesanese.

Tip: Cash and card. Open 12:30 to 23:00; reservations only after 19:00 for tables of four or more.

Trattoria Da Teo ★ 4.2

Roman trattoria€€trastevere

Trattoria Da Teo in Rome's Trastevere is the family-run pasta-and-pizza room with a piazza-side terrace, classic Roman primi and a quiet wine list of Lazio reds.

Signature: Cacio e pepe, Saltimbocca, Tonnarelli

Order: Cacio e pepe, saltimbocca alla romana and a half-litre of house wine.

Tip: Book a fortnight ahead for the piazza terrace. Closed Sunday all day.
